WebThere are three major methods to measure bioavailability: Protein Efficiency Ratio (PER) looks at weight gain from protein intake. Net Protein Utilization (NPU) looks at protein intake and nitrogen excretion. Biological Value (BV) also looks at intake vs. excretion but in a stricter, more controlled way than NPU.
